Fendt 1Z or Leyland 154?

Which should you choose?

The data can’t decide this. Power at the PTO shaft cannot be compared: the 1Z has only engine power (gross or net not stated), claimed — a different quantity from power at the shaft; the 154 has only engine power (gross or net not stated), claimed — a different quantity from power at the shaft.

  • The Leyland 154 suits road haulage better on this data: 25% (5.0 km/h / 3.1 mph) more top speed.

What decides it, question by question?

Buyer questions for Fendt 1Z and Leyland 154, with the call on each
Question1Z154Call
Which puts more power through the PTO shaft?18.3 kW (24.5 hp)Traktorenlexikon, “Fendt Farmer 1 Z”18.6 kW (24.9 hp)Traktorenlexikon, “Leyland 154”Not comparableNot comparable on power at the PTO shaft: the 1Z has only engine power (gross or net not stated), claimed — a different quantity from power at the shaft; the 154 has only engine power (gross or net not stated), claimed — a different quantity from power at the shaft.
Which turns a litre of fuel into more work at the shaft?No figureNo call on fuel efficiency at the shaft: no figure on record for the 1Z and the 154.
Which pulls harder at the drawbar?No figureNo call on drawbar power: no figure on record for the 1Z and the 154.
Which pumps more oil for implements?15.0 L/min (4.0 gpm)Traktorenlexikon, “Fendt Farmer 1 Z”14.5 L/min (3.8 gpm)Traktorenlexikon, “Leyland 154”EvenEven on hydraulic flow (both pump flow, as stated by the source): the difference is under the 10% threshold, too small to call.
Which lifts more on the three-point hitch?1,185 kg (2,612 lb)Traktorenlexikon, “Fendt Farmer 1 Z”454 kg (1,001 lb)Traktorenlexikon, “Leyland 154”Not comparableNot comparable on three-point lift: the 1Z: lift at the hitch ends, as stated by the source (Traktorenlexikon, “Fendt Farmer 1 Z”); the 154: lift through the full range at the hitch ends, as stated by the source (Traktorenlexikon, “Leyland 154”) — not the same quantity, basis and condition.
Which is heavier, for traction?1,595 kg (3,516 lb)Traktorenlexikon, “Fendt Farmer 1 Z”1,007 kg (2,220 lb) to 1,032 kg (2,275 lb)Traktorenlexikon, “Leyland 154”Ahead (a fact, not an advantage)The Fendt 1Z is 55% heavier (563 kg / 1,241 lb) than the Leyland 154 (both unladen weight, as stated by the source).
Which may carry more ballast and load?2,040 kg (4,497 lb)Traktorenlexikon, “Fendt Farmer 1 Z”No figureNo call on maximum permissible mass: no figure on record for the 154.
Which has the wider choice of gears?6Traktorenlexikon, “Fendt Farmer 1 Z”9Traktorenlexikon, “Leyland 154”AheadThe Leyland 154 has 50% more forward gears (3 gears) than the Fendt 1Z (both forward gears, as stated by the source).
Which offers a creeper range?YesTraktorenlexikon, “Fendt Farmer 1 Z”No figureNo call on a creeper range: not stated for the 154.
Which is faster on the road?20 km/h (12.4 mph)Traktorenlexikon, “Fendt Farmer 1 Z”25 km/h (15.5 mph)Traktorenlexikon, “Leyland 154”AheadThe Leyland 154 has 25% more top speed (5.0 km/h / 3.1 mph) than the Fendt 1Z (both top speed forward, as stated by the source).
Which offers more PTO speeds?585 rpmTraktorenlexikon, “Fendt Farmer 1 Z”540 rpmTraktorenlexikon, “Leyland 154”No figureNo call on PTO speeds: no standard PTO speed stated for the 1Z.
Which PTO runs independently of the ground drive?dependent (stops with the clutch)Traktorenlexikon, “Fendt Farmer 1 Z”No figureNo call on PTO independence: not stated for the 154.
Which drives on both axles?2WDTraktorenlexikon, “Fendt Farmer 1 Z”2WDTraktorenlexikon, “Leyland 154”EvenEven on drive: all two-wheel drive.
Which is newer, and what about parts?1963–19671969–1972Ahead (a fact, not an advantage)The Leyland 154 is newer: production began 6 years later. We hold no parts-availability data, so there is no call on parts.
